How much do part time community health worker j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time community health worker in the United States is $21.60,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.27 and $24.04 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time community health worker?

To thrive as a Part Time Community Health Worker, you need a solid understanding of community health principles, basic health education, and usually a high school diploma or equivalent with relevant training. Familiarity with case management software, electronic health records, and local health resources is typically required. Outstanding interpersonal skills, cultural competence, and the ability to build trust with diverse populations help individuals excel in this role. These skills are crucial for effectively connecting communities to health services, improving health outcomes, and fostering positive relationships.

What are some common challenges faced by part time community health workers, and how can they be addressed?

Part-time Community Health Workers may encounter challenges such as balancing a variable schedule, maintaining consistent communication with clients, and staying updated on community resources. To address these, it's helpful to establish clear routines, make use of digital tools for scheduling and client follow-up, and maintain regular check-ins with supervisors and team members. Proactively engaging in ongoing training and networking within the community also helps part-time workers stay informed and effective in their role.

What is a part time community health worker?

Part Time Community Health Workers are professionals who work within local communities, often on a flexible or reduced-hour schedule, to promote health education, provide basic health services, and connect people with healthcare resources. They serve as a bridge between the community and healthcare providers, helping to improve access to care and health outcomes. Their duties may include conducting outreach, providing health information, assisting with screenings, and supporting individuals in navigating health and social service systems. Part time roles allow for flexible work hours, making it a suitable option for those balancing other commitments.

What is the difference between Part Time Community Health Worker vs Part Time Medical Assistant?

AspectPart Time Community Health WorkerPart Time Medical Assistant
CredentialsHigh school diploma; some roles may require certificationHigh school diploma; certification often preferred
Work EnvironmentCommunity settings, clinics, outreach programsMedical offices, clinics, hospitals
Employer & IndustryHealthcare organizations, public health agenciesHospitals, outpatient clinics, physician offices

Both roles involve supporting patient care and health education, but Community Health Workers focus on community outreach and education, while Medical Assistants perform clinical and administrative tasks in healthcare facilities. The choice depends on whether you prefer community-based work or clinical support roles.

Seeking Two Part-Time Community Health Workers (CHWs) – Family Home Visiting Research Project


Languages: Seeking one Spanish-speaking and one Somali-speaking CHW


Location: Twin Cities Metro Area - Minnesota


About Us: CHW Solutions is an industry leader in Community Health Worker service delivery, improving health outcomes and decreasing health disparities. Our philosophy brings gold standard CHW care to patients, driven by compassion and fueled by a diverse workforce. Join our vibrant and growing team today!


Role Overview: We are seeking two part-time extremely responsible Community Health Workers (CHWs) who are passionate about coaching families with preschool aged children, supporting their adoption of healthy family routines and behaviors. These CHW roles involve delivering home visiting services to families over a six-month period, following a curriculum modified from the NET-Works study (https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/37171137/). This CDC-funded research project is a partnership with the University of Minnesota and will examine the model’s implementation with families referred from three Twin Cities Federally Qualified Health Centers (FQHCs). Outcomes and impact will be measured through standardized data collection. CHWs will conduct visits in patients’ homes following best practices.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Deliver a series of six monthly home visits (2-3 home visits per week) to families with preschool aged children referred from Neighborhood HealthSource and Southside Community Health Services clinics.
  • Work with families to set goals and implement routines (meal and snack time, playtime and bedtime).
  • Utilize Motivational Interviewing, positive parenting skills and other coaching methods to help families adopt individualized and culturally relevant routines.
  • Engage families in interactive activities supporting child development and active play.
  • Facilitate 2-3 check-ins with families weekly between home visits via telephone, Zoom, email, or text messages.
  • Document home visits in CHW Solutions’ Electronic Health Record.
  • Gather research related information and input it into a University of Minnesota REDCap electronic database.
  • Deliver health promotion topics and connect families to community resources in culturally and linguistically relevant ways.
  • Complete all required research training, including CITI IRB, REDCap electronic database and NET-Works intervention curriculum.
  • Attend biweekly team meetings (approximately 1 hour) with University of Minnesota research staff to debrief on home visits and the overall implementation process, and to update study protocol as needed.
